🏝️ Batanes: The Philippines’ Northernmost Paradise – Your Ultimate Travel Guide
#holidayitinerary
### **Why Visit Batanes?**
1. **Untouched Natural Beauty**: Known as the "Home of the Winds," Batanes boasts dramatic landscapes—rolling hills, rugged cliffs, and crystal-clear waters—often compared to New Zealand or Scotland .
2. **Unique Ivatan Culture**: Experience the traditions of the Ivatan people, from their iconic **stone houses** (built to withstand typhoons) to their honest and egalitarian community values .
3. **UNESCO Tentative Site**: Recognized for its pristine ecosystems and cultural heritage, Batanes is a candidate for the **World Heritage List** .
---
### **Top Attractions**
#### **1. Batan Island**
- **Marlboro Hills (Rakuh a Payaman)**: Endless green pastures with grazing cows and panoramic ocean views .
- **Basco Lighthouse**: A picturesque spot for sunset photos .
- **Vayang Rolling Hills**: Hike through lush hills with sweeping coastal vistas .
#### **2. Sabtang Island**
- **Chamantad-Tinyan Viewpoint**: A jaw-dropping cliffside panorama .
- **Traditional Ivatan Villages**: Visit **Savidug** and **Chavayan** to see centuries-old stone houses .
- **Morong Beach**: A white-sand cove with a natural rock arch .
#### **3. Itbayat Island**
- **Torongan Cave**: A historic landing site of early Austronesian migrants .
- **Rapang Cliffs**: Towering limestone formations overlooking the sea .
---
### **Practical Guide**
- **Best Time to Visit**: **March–May** (dry season) for clear skies and calm seas. Avoid **June–November** (typhoon season) .
- **How to Get There**:
- **Flights**: Philippine Airlines (PAL) operates daily 1.5-hour flights from Manila to **Basco Airport** .
- **Boats**: Ferries connect Batan to Sabtang (40 mins) and Itbayat (4 hours, weather-dependent) .
- **Transport on Islands**: Rent **tricycles** (PHP 500–1,000/day) or join guided van tours .
---
### **Unique Experiences**
- **Honesty Coffee Shop**: A self-service stall where you pay on trust—no cashier! .
- **Ivatan Cuisine**: Try **uvud** (banana pith meatballs) and **vunes** (dried taro stalks) .
- **Wildlife Spotting**: Free-roaming cows, horses, and rare birds like the **Ivatan hornbill** .
---
### **Visitor Tips**
- **Respect Local Customs**: Avoid disturbing grazing animals or entering private lands without permission .
- **Pack Light Layers**: Weather shifts quickly; bring a windbreaker and sunscreen .
- **Book Early**: Accommodations are limited—homestays and small hotels fill fast .

📍Note
✔️Renting a bike is cheaper in roaming around
•Japanese bike 25php
•Mountain bike 50php
✔️Expect to trek going to spring of youth
✔️No wifi in basco destroyed by typhoon
✔️Reach out to locals, immerse yourself to their culture
✔️Dont miss star gazing in naidi or in rolling hills(must try)felt peaceful
✔️Souvenirs- buying in sabtang is cheaper compared to basco.
✔️Tawsen and bisumi souvenirs are the cheapest shops in basco if you want a customized shirt pasalubong
✔️Wear the ivatan traditional costume
✔️Packing light, bring cup noodles and canned goods cook in your homestay to save some cash
✔️Plan ahead your itinerary going to sabtang and Itbayat to avoid getting straded
✔️ Expect brownout in sabtang 12midnight to 6am
✔️ if you plan to visit sabtang or itbayat prepare yourself to a bumpy ride(must bring bonamide)
✔️only landbank and PNB are the ATM machines available in basco
✔️try the local food(Coconut crab)

The most interesting part for me is the Honesty Cafe,It is a sari sari store and coffee shop combined what's fascinating here is that there is no one looking for the merchandise here,there is this price list of the items and a drop box where you can put your payment.

Chasing chilly waves & adventure in Basco? My top must-see is Valugan Boulder Beach — a wild, wind-swept corner of Batanes perfect for landscape lovers and moody photo vibes 🌊🌫️
If you crave rugged beauty, Valugan Boulder Beach is your go-to spot! Located along Contra Costa Rd, this stretch isn't your typical sandy getaway. Instead, you'll find yourself clambering over giant volcanic boulders, with crashing waves and distant misty hills giving off total “edge of the world” energy. Trust me, sturdy shoes are a lifesaver here (the rocks are slippery and the surf is cold, so dress for the wind and always watch your step!).
While the weather can shift fast — think cloudy, rainy, and unpredictable — that just adds to the drama of Valugan. Bring a raincoat, keep your camera ready, and visit early before the crowds trickle in. Mornings are especially quiet, and even if the skies are moody, the view is seriously next level.
Getting around Basco is easiest by renting a bike or tricycle, both affordable and fun ways to explore at your own pace. Don’t skip the local fresh seafood or Ivatan cuisine in town; try casa Napoli for pizza or Octagon for local dishes.
Quick tip: There’s no shade or bathrooms at the beach, so prepare accordingly and pack out any trash. And always check the tide before visiting!

Basco Beach Bliss🌞
Valugan Boulder Beach—often spelled Vulugan by locals—is one of the most striking natural landmarks in Batanes, known for its dramatic coastline, volcanic history, and raw, untouched beauty. Located on the eastern side of Batan Island near Basco, this three‑kilometer stretch is famous not for sand, but for thousands of smooth, rounded andesite boulders that blanket the entire shoreline. These massive stones were formed after Mt. Iraya erupted around 400 AD, scattering volcanic rocks across the area. Over centuries, the relentless waves and strong Pacific winds polished these rocks into the smooth boulders seen today, creating a landscape unlike any other in the Philippines.

Basco Lighthouse - One of the iconic symbols of Batanes
#falladventures
#travel
#familytravel
This is one of the lighthouses built in Batanes around the year 2000 to guide seafarers safely to the shore. While recently constructed, it has become one of the popular landmarks of Batanes, specifically of Basco in Batan Island, where it is located. You can climb its 83-step stairs right up to the top and enjoy the scenic view of the surrounding sea and Naidi Hills. On the ground floor, there's a small room that serves as a mini-museum, and close to the lighthouse is a big signage saying "I ♡ Batanes," great for photo shoots. It's a must-visit place when you're in Batanes. Everything is just breathtaking when you're in the province, or I am just being biased because it's my favorite place in PH.
